What is a divan bed?
In short
A divan is a box-like upholstered base that supports a mattress. Tops may be solid platform or sprung-edge, and many include drawers. The mattress sits on the box rather than on an open bedstead with visible legs and slats alone.
More detail
Platform-top divans are rigid; sprung-edge divans add base give. Ottoman lift-up storage is a related but distinct gas-strut system.
